  • @TheClasax That is always a good question - how to sound musical on any instrument. Starting at 37 is not too old. In fact, you are never too old to learn a brass instrument or any musical instrument for that matter! Trumpet players (and this applies to all brass players) practice long tones, where they hold the note for an extended period and get priogressively louder and then softer. They also practice what are called "breath" attacks to start a note more delicately as a practice aid.

  • @TheClasax I would also suggest that you lear how to position your tongue. You do not "attack" a note but rather release your air, by taking your tongue away from in front of your air stream. The closer your tongue is to your teeth before removing it determines how sharp an attack you will have. Thus, if the tongue is behind the teeth or even between the teeth, it will be a much sharper attack than if starting from the roof of your mouth (i.e. the hard palate).

  • For those who don't know who Derek Watkins is, he is an incredible trumpet player and is the regular lead trumpet for the James Last Orchestra. You can hear Derek playing in the upper register on recordings of the old James Bond movies. The trumpet he plays is a Smith-Watkins which he helped design.
